Understanding Wiper Blade Designs for Wet Conditions

Wiper blades are generally categorized into three primary designs: conventional, beam, and hybrid. Conventional wiper blades utilize a metal bracket framework with multiple pressure points to press the rubber blade against the glass. While highly common and cost-effective, their exposed metal joints can collect road debris and are more susceptible to wind lift at higher speeds.

Beam wiper blades, also known as flat blades, feature a tensioned steel band inside a continuous rubber housing. This design allows the blade to conform more uniformly to the curvature of modern windshields, distributing pressure evenly across the entire wiping edge. Because they lack an external metal frame, beam blades are highly aerodynamic and less prone to lifting off the glass when driving on highways during heavy rain.

Hybrid wiper blades combine the aerodynamic, enclosed shell of a beam blade with the robust, articulated structure of a conventional frame. This hybrid design provides the strong, localized pressure of bracketed blades while maintaining a sleek, wind-resistant profile. Many modern vehicles come equipped with hybrid blades from the factory to balance aesthetic appeal with high-speed wiping performance.

Before purchasing any replacement wiper set, it is essential to verify your vehicle’s original equipment manufacturer (OEM) specifications. Different car makes and models utilize distinct wiper arm mounting mechanisms, such as J-hooks, side pins, bayonet fittings, or pinch tabs. While many aftermarket wiper sets include universal adapters, confirming your vehicle’s specific connector type prevents installation issues and ensures a secure, wobble-free fit.

Comparing Bosch, 3M, and Denso: What to Look For

When evaluating Bosch wiper sets, look closely at their product packaging to identify the specific frame technology and rubber compound used. Bosch is widely recognized for its development of beam blade technology, often incorporating integrated aerodynamic spoilers designed to channel airflow and press the blade firmly against the glass at highway speeds. Their product lines frequently feature dual-rubber compounds, combining a hard wiping edge for clean sweeps with a flexible soft-rubber base to reduce operational noise.

3M focuses heavily on material science, offering wiper sets that emphasize synthetic rubber formulations engineered to withstand extreme environmental stress. When examining 3M options, pay attention to their frameless designs, which are engineered to adapt to highly curved windshields. Their packaging typically highlights resistance to dry heat and ozone degradation, making them a strong candidate for vehicles that spend significant time parked outdoors under direct sunlight.

Denso is a prominent original equipment supplier for many Asian vehicle manufacturers, meaning their aftermarket wiper sets are often designed to mirror factory specifications exactly. If you prefer to maintain your vehicle’s original aesthetic and wiping dynamics, Denso’s hybrid and conventional lines are worth close inspection. Their hybrid blades feature a fully covered, low-profile black shell that protects the internal tension structure from UV exposure and road grime while maintaining a clean, factory-installed appearance.

Regardless of the brand you choose, never rely on a generic vehicle compatibility list on a retail shelf or online marketplace. Always measure your existing wiper blades manually or consult your vehicle’s owner’s manual to verify the exact lengths required for both the driver and passenger sides. Using the incorrect length can lead to blades colliding during operation, leaving large unwiped patches on the glass, or damaging the surrounding windshield trim.

Evaluating Blade Materials and Build Quality

The material composition of the wiping element is the single most critical factor determining how long a wiper set will last before streaking. Natural rubber is highly flexible and provides an exceptionally clean, quiet wipe on clean glass, but it degrades relatively quickly when exposed to intense tropical heat and UV radiation. Over time, natural rubber can become brittle, crack, or develop a permanent set, preventing it from making full contact with the windshield.

Synthetic rubber compounds, such as Ethylene Propylene Diene Monomer (EPDM), offer significantly higher resistance to heat, ozone, and UV exposure than natural rubber. EPDM blades maintain their flexibility across a wider temperature range, reducing the likelihood of the wiping edge hardening or warping during dry spells. For drivers in tropical climates, checking product labels for synthetic rubber construction can be a reliable indicator of long-term durability.

Silicone wiper blades represent another premium material option, known for their extreme thermal stability and ability to deposit a thin, water-repellent film on the glass as they wipe. However, silicone blades require a thoroughly clean windshield to operate quietly, as any residual oil or road film can cause them to chatter or squeak. When reading product packaging, look for mentions of friction-reducing coatings like graphite or Teflon (PTFE), which are applied to the wiping edge to ensure smooth, silent operation across varying moisture levels.

Before purchasing, inspect the physical build quality of the wiper set if possible. Gently flex the rubber wiping edge to ensure it is supple and free of micro-tears or manufacturing defects. For conventional and hybrid designs, check that the frame joints move freely without excessive play or rattling, as loose joints can cause uneven pressure distribution and lead to premature streaking.

Choosing the Right Wiper Set for Your Vehicle

To select the most suitable wiper set, match the brand’s design strengths to your primary driving environment and vehicle specifications. Choose Bosch if you frequently drive on highways and expressways where high-speed wind lift is a concern. Their beam blades with integrated aerodynamic spoilers are designed to maintain consistent contact with the glass at high speeds, making them highly effective for long-distance commuters who require reliable visibility during heavy downpours.

Choose 3M if your vehicle has a highly curved windshield or if you prioritize advanced synthetic rubber formulations designed to resist dry heat. Their frameless designs conform well to complex glass geometries, ensuring that the outer edges of the blades do not lift or leave streaks. This makes them an excellent option for modern sedans and crossovers with swept-back windshield profiles that require uniform pressure distribution.

Choose Denso if you drive a vehicle that came equipped with hybrid blades from the factory and you wish to preserve the original wiping performance and aesthetic. Denso’s hybrid wiper sets provide a precise, OEM-equivalent fit that matches the structural tension and aerodynamic profile designed by your vehicle’s manufacturer. This is particularly beneficial for Japanese and Korean vehicle owners looking for a seamless, factory-standard replacement.

Before finalizing your purchase, always verify if your vehicle requires a proprietary connector or a specific blade curvature that standard universal wiper sets cannot accommodate. Some European and late-model vehicles use specialized wiper arm attachments that require dedicated adapters, which may not be included in every standard retail box. Confirming these details beforehand prevents the inconvenience of purchasing an incompatible wiper set.

Installation Checks and Maintenance for Clear Visibility

Replacing a wiper set is a straightforward task, but it requires careful handling to avoid costly damage to your vehicle. When removing the old wiper blades, never leave the bare metal wiper arm raised in the air unattended. If the spring-loaded arm accidentally snaps back down onto the windshield without the rubber blade attached, the metal hook can easily crack or shatter the glass. Always place a folded towel or a thick piece of cardboard on the windshield directly beneath the wiper arm to act as a protective cushion during the swap.

Once the new blades are securely installed, take the time to clean your windshield thoroughly. Road film, tree sap, insect residue, and wax from car washes can accumulate on the glass, creating a barrier that causes even brand-new wiper blades to skip, chatter, or leave streaks. Use a dedicated automotive glass cleaner and a clean microfiber towel to remove these contaminants, and gently wipe the rubber element of the new blades with a damp cloth to remove any manufacturing dust or shipping residue.

Regularly inspect the condition of your wiper system and know when to seek professional assistance. If you notice that the wiper arms are bent, the tension springs have lost their strength, or the wiper motor struggles to move the blades even on a wet windshield, simple blade replacement may not resolve the issue. In these cases, consult a qualified automotive technician to inspect the wiper linkage, motor, and arm alignment to ensure your vehicle’s visibility system operates safely and effectively.

How often should I replace my wiper blades in tropical climates?

In tropical environments characterized by intense sunlight, high humidity, and heavy seasonal rainfall, wiper blades generally require replacement every six to twelve months. Rather than relying strictly on a calendar schedule, monitor your blades for physical signs of degradation. If you observe persistent streaking, skipping across the glass, squeaking noises, or visible cracks and tears in the rubber element, it is time to install a new wiper set to maintain safe driving visibility.

Can I mix different wiper blade brands on the same car?

While it is physically possible to install different wiper blade brands or frame designs on the driver and passenger sides, doing so is generally not recommended. Different brands and frame types—such as pairing a beam blade with a conventional bracket blade—often exert different levels of pressure against the glass. This mismatch can result in uneven wiping patterns, inconsistent clearing speeds, and distracting visual asymmetry across your windshield during heavy rain.
